Yo extra long episode with Tokyo's dopest Studio owner, producer Ghostpops (South Africa) and writer MC artist, Kraftykid (UK). We touch on a lot of topics this episode. Racial profiling in tokyo, the "grimiest" parts of Tokyo, race and japanese arti... more
Year 6 Episode 1! Yo I am back with new Mega Late Show content! As usually we are rocking with some of the most talented, interesting and accomplished people in Tokyo Japan! Today I got two of my long time homegirls, dancers: Yinka Oshitelu and Ktea ... more
Peace! This episode was recorded several months ago. i fucked around and deleted the video of it and then got lazy to edit the audio. but here we are!! finally. my apologies. I give a kind a long update on the state of the podcast before the recordin... more
Hello, Back with another installment of the interviews about infection rates. This joint features good good friend of the pod a.k.a. DJ Double El who goes by too many monikers to list out. We get into a bit of vaccine talk and try to hash out some re... more
